Ensure your service provider is qualified and competent to handle your aircraft. Different aircraft have different operating procedures. You should check whether your handler has an International Standard for Business Aircraft Handling certification. This is an award given by the International Business Aviation Council. You will need to provide the service provider with information in advance, such as crew and passenger information, aircraft registration, certificate of airworthiness, insurance and your schedule. Different service providers have different procedures and you may need to provide some companies with more notice than others, of your intended arrival. You should confirm your equipment needs in advance with your supplier, since they may need to acquire the correct equipment for your aircraft, such as chocks, tie-down equipment, control locks and aircraft canopy covers. If you require fuel for your onward flight, you should inform the service provider so that they can make the correct arrangements. Airport Services can be found on the AvPay Airport Directory.
Booking qualified aircraft handling agents is crucial when operating an aircraft from an airport due to several reasons. Qualified handling agents prioritize safety, ensuring that all aircraft operations are conducted with the utmost care and adherence to safety protocols. They are familiar with aviation regulations and ensure that all operations comply with legal requirements and industry standards. Qualified agents possess specialized knowledge and skills specific to aircraft handling, allowing them to handle various operational challenges effectively. They optimize processes, coordinate ground services, and minimize delays, resulting in efficient turnaround times for aircraft operations. Qualified agents are trained in risk assessment and mitigation, minimizing potential hazards and improving overall operational safety. They have a deep understanding of the equipment used in aircraft handling, ensuring proper utilization and maintenance. Qualified agents are trained to handle emergencies promptly and effectively, ensuring the safety of passengers, crew, and the aircraft itself. They liaise with various stakeholders, including airlines, ground service providers, and airport authorities, to ensure smooth coordination of all operational activities. Qualified agents provide excellent customer service, addressing passenger and crew needs promptly and professionally. They have established relationships with industry suppliers and service providers, allowing them to access necessary resources and expedite operations. Working with qualified agents enhances an airline’s reputation for reliability, safety, and professionalism. Qualified agents’ expertise and efficiency contribute to cost savings by minimizing delays, optimizing resources, and avoiding unnecessary expenses. Booking only qualified aircraft handling agents is essential to ensure safe, compliant, efficient, and reliable aircraft operations, benefiting both passengers and airlines.
